Transportation ManagerWe are in search of a Transportation Manager to join our growing team. This role will be responsible for leading and supporting a team Drivers and two Leads to ensure safe, efficient, and timely delivery operations. This role oversees driver performance, compliance with company policies and DOT regulations, fleet coordination, and day-to-day operational execution. The Transportation Manager works closely with warehouse leadership, branch management, and external partners to support productivity, safety initiatives, accurate payroll, and overall branch goals. This position also plays an active role in safety leadership and cross-functional collaboration to support fluctuating business needs.
Responsibilities Include: - Selects, trains, motivates, and lead a team of drivers.
- Educates staff on current policies and procedures as well as promotes company specific programs relating to safety initiatives.
- Responsible for maintaining a cohesive working relationship with Penske while ensuring that fleet cost for fuel, maintenance, leases and rentals are accurate.
- Establish a good working relationship with each Driver to promote a cohesive working relationship supporting goal attainment.
- Appraise performance and recommend salary and disciplinary actions.
- Create an excellent working relationship with Warehouse Leads, and Warehouse Manager and Leads (AM/PM).
- Participate as a key member of the Branch management and Safety Committee team.
- Approve time cards, overtime, and requests for time off ensuring payroll is accurate for each Driver.
- Measure and record Driver performance and productivity as it relates to route completion and safe driving.
- Provide employees (Drivers) to assist in the warehouse and other functions during fluctuations of work load.
- Conduct weekly meetings with the Warehouse Manager to review the following; prior week's load performance, Reverse logistics process, go-again issues, upcoming scheduling challenges, same day requests, on-boarding notification of new employees and or personnel issues, etc.
- Other duties as assigned.
